After the application of "Tong Xiaowu" during the Wuzhen Summit was implemented on the Leqi AI glasses, Ant's self-developed intelligent terminal trusted connection technology framework GPASS is further expanding its application boundaries. Recently, the city tour guide feature based on this technology has been officially launched in the new version of the Leqi AI glasses.

Once users activate the tour guide mode, they can achieve real-time interactive experiences of obtaining information while walking through the Leqi AI glasses. The system can provide explanations of nearby attractions based on the user's location and support instant Q&A, navigation, first-person content recording and sharing, reducing manual operations while enhancing the continuity and immersion of the trip.
As the first city cultural and tourism official AI agent to join this service, the arrival of "Hang Xiaoyi" marks that the "Mirror Tour Hangzhou" project has entered the practical operation phase. This project was jointly created by Hangzhou Cultural Tourism, Alipay, and Leqi, aiming to explore the integration of AI with city cultural and tourism services. In the future, the city tour guide function will gradually be integrated with more city-specific cultural and tourism AI agents.
From the perspective of functional experience, this upgrade mainly manifests in three aspects:
First, it enhances the depth of information access. In addition to traditional navigation and guidance, the system can supplement knowledge about buildings, cultural history, and related cultural content based on the surrounding environment near the user, helping them better understand what they see and hear systematically.
Second, it enhances multi-functional collaboration capabilities. Functions such as conversation, photography, translation, navigation, payment, and audio playback can be switched and accessed through voice, and even when in tour guide mode, other functions can still be used without affecting the overall experience, making it more seamless.
Third, it optimizes the interaction method. Based on comprehensive recognition capabilities of voice, image, and location information, the system can actively provide prompts and explanations in specific scenarios without requiring a wake-up word to start a conversation, filtering out environmental noise and irrelevant intentions. From previous passive responses, it now transitions to a more continuous interactive experience.
This innovative experience is supported by the powerful Ant GPASS intelligent terminal trusted connection technology framework. GPASS accurately captures user needs through multimodal intent understanding of voice + image + location; achieves smooth dialogue and navigation interactions on the glasses; and ensures trusted connections with city cultural and tourism AI agents like "Hang Xiaoyi," making the service both smart and secure.
